Zelensky to hold closed NSDC meeting on Saturday

Ukrinform
President of Ukraine Volodymyr Zelensky will hold a closed meeting of the National Security and Defense Council of Ukraine (NSDC) ahead of a Normandy Four summit.

NSDC Secretary Oleksiy Danilov stated this after a meeting dedicated to the preparations for the Normandy Four summit, according to the NSDC website.

"Following the meeting, the decision was made to hold a closed meeting of the National Security and Defense Council of Ukraine on Saturday, December 7,” reads the report.

As Ukrinform reported, five scenarios for the reintegration of the temporarily occupied territories of Donbas was approved at a coordination meeting held at the Office of the President of Ukraine on December 3.

The Normandy Four summit is scheduled for December 9. The meeting of the leaders of Ukraine, Germany, France and Russia in the Normandy Format will be held in Paris.
